The hexadecimal color code #37171F corresponds to the code RGB( 55, 23, 31 ). It's a shade of Red. This color is a combination of red (at 0,22 level), green (at 0,09 level) and blue (at 0,12 level). Its brightness is 15% and its saturation is 41%. It is composed of red at 50%, green at 21% and blue at 28%.

The complementary color #C8E8E0 is the color exactly opposite to #37171F on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.
